Abstract
The utility model relates to a kind of wireless network access scheme, including a wireless controller, at least a core switch, several POE interchangers and several hotspot devices, each floor is equipped with a POE interchanger and several hotspot devices;The POE interchanger includes casing, microcontroller, power module, touch screen, display module, POE system module, switch system module, the microcontroller is connect with the display module, touch screen, POE system module and switch system module respectively by bus, and the power module is connect with the microcontroller, POE system module and switch system module respectively.Compared with prior art, the utility model POE interchanger is equipped with touch screen and display screen, the difficulty of setting, debugging is reduced, to reduce the workload of overall network daily maintenance.

As shown in figure 3, this system use POE interchanger 3 include casing 17, microcontroller, power module, touch screen,
Display module, POE system module, switch system module, microcontroller by bus respectively with display module, touch screen, POE
System module is connected with switch system module, power module respectively with microcontroller, POE system module and switch system mould
Block connection.The working condition of microcontroller real-time monitoring POE system module and switch system module, can be by resetting POE system
The normal work for the module and switch system module recovery POE interchanger 3 of uniting, and relevant information is shown by display module.
Display module includes LCD display 18, and LCD display 18 and touch screen are set on casing 17.Casing 17 refers to equipped with work
Show lamp, AC power supplies socket 19, power switch 20 and POE network interface.
The specific work process of POE interchanger 3 includes: after power module is to each module for power supply, and microprocessor starts
Work.Whether microprocessor detection POE system module first works normally, if do not worked normally, first fault message is led to
It crosses display module to show, and resets POE system module, work normally POE system module;If can not be made by resetting
POE system module works normally, and microprocessor can control POE system module from service, and display module shows warning message,
It notifies administrator to handle as early as possible, avoids power failure further expansion.If POE system module can work normally, micro process
Whether device detection switch system module works normally, if do not worked normally, first fault message is shown by display module
It shows and, and reset switch system module, work normally switch system module;If interchanger can not be made by resetting
System module works normally, and microprocessor can control switch system module from service, and display module shows warning message,
It notifies administrator to handle as early as possible, avoids power failure further expansion.When microprocessor detect POE system module with exchange
When machine module can work normally, display screen 18 can come out the status display of each port of POE system, include whether POE
Function, port power have No-mistake Principle, port to have connectionless PD, all of the port output general power, POE output general power etc..Work as POE
Interchanger 3 in POE interchanger 3 increases touch screen as human-computer interaction interface after powering on, allow site operation personnel can according to
Different parameters are arranged in the actual conditions for the terminal device that POE interchanger 3 connects in real time.Option includes: on display screen 18
3 setting options of POE interchanger, POE interchanger 3 are to POE port switch setting options, the setting choosing of the PD type of POE interchanger 3
Item, port setting options etc..
